SUMMARY
The
Payroll Coordinator is responsible for administering the company's retirement and benefits programs as well as the accurate and timely processing of payroll for both union and non-union team members.
**Retirement & Benefits
- Administers the company's retirement and benefits programs.
- Responds to team members' inquiries and provides guidance on retirement and benefits matters.
- Coordinates retirement and benefits program activities and requirements including but not limited to annual benefit reenrollment process; processing of new hires, terminations and employee coverage changes with internal stakeholders and the vendors.
- Performs calculations for items including but not limited to employee Group RRSP contributions, yearend Group RRSP company match amount, etc.
- Provides data reporting and assists with data analysis to support retirement and benefits program review, changes and all other decision making process pertaining to the programs. Assists in the identification and implementation of retirement and benefits program enhancements.
- Processes payrolls for union and nonunion employees according to established schedules.
- Reviews applicable collective agreements and ensures thorough understanding of all pay elements and schedules for various collective agreements representing unionized team members across the company.
- Reviews applicable policies and documentations and ensures thorough understanding of all pay elements for nonunionized team members.
- Responsible for accurate processing of all payroll elements including but not limited to employee pay, payroll deductions and remittances.
- Performs calculations for items including but not limited to payroll deductions and remittances.
- Executes annual and yearend payroll activities such as T4 preparation, merit and incentive pay payments.
- Conducts audit of payroll records to ensure integrity and compliance with all requirements.
- Assists in the identification and implementation of payroll process and systems enhancements.
